powered by simpleCommunicator - 2.0.19     © 2024 Programmizd 02
Map
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Точность задания высоты строки
2 сообщений из 2, страница 1 из 1
Точность задания высоты строки
    #40112475
faustgreen
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Вывожу на печать один и тот же документ открытый в разных версиях Excel.
В результате получаю разное количество строк на листе.
Посмотрел в чем может быть причина, оказалось, что высота строк в документе разная (в разных версиях Excel):

1) Excel 97 - ширина строки 11.25.
2) Excel 2013 - ширина строки 11.3.

Отличие в точности высоты, в одном случае это один знак после запятой, в другом - два.
Тут возникает первый вопрос - можно ли через настройки задать точность высоты (я не нашел), или же это зависит от версии Excel (возможно, что в определенный момент разрабы решили, что достаточно одного знака после запятой)?

Окей, чтобы устранить проблему задаю для документа высоту, где второй знак после запятой = 0 (например, 12.00 для 97-го и 12.0 для 2013 excel). Теперь высота строк стала одинаковой при открытии в разных версиях Excel.

Казалось бы, проблема должна уйти, и страницы будут выглядеть одинаково.
Но при выводе на печать опять получаем разный результат (хотя вместо трех лишних строк, теперь выводится лишь одна, но все же).
Тут второй вопрос - какая причина теперь? Визуально выглядит так, как будто высота все равно различается, либо же расстояние от текста до границ ячейки разное (различие по высоте небольшое, поэтому трудно определить).
...
Рейтинг: 0 / 0
Точность задания высоты строки
    #40116208
ldfanate
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
давно в xl97-ые времена тоже с таким сталкивался, при печати постранично огромных портянок инвентаризационных описей. Там всяко пробовал, application.inchestopoints, опрос через API драйвера принтер, и прочие способы добиться вычисления правильного коэффициента пересчёта под конкретный принтер.
В итоге тупо на эмпирическую константу 0,97-0,98 оказалось проще.

Там и сама экселька, и разметка драйвером печати под конкретный принтер, привносят к высоте колонтитулов, шапок таблиц и прочего какието дополнительные сдвиги, приводящие к изменению масштаба на печатной странице.
...
Рейтинг: 0 / 0
2 сообщений из 2, страница 1 из 1
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Точность задания высоты строки
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Найденые пользователи ...
Разблокировать пользователей ...
Читали тему (0):
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]